This episode comes out on GOOD FRIDAY, as we mark the death of Jesus, sacrificing himself on the Cross. And on Easter, we celebrate God's Son rising from the grave, conquering death as a Savior for our sin. I asked a diversity of faith leaders across Georgia (many in Columbus) and Alabama - who have been previous podcast guests over the 5+ years of "Run The Race" - to share about the significance and power of Easter...and how/why we celebrate what Jesus did for us. They have some fantastic insight that will inspire and tech you, heading into this holiday weekend.
